Bad Nagar
Bad Nagar is a village located in Kumbhraj tehsil of Guna district in Madhya Pradesh, India. It is situated 75km away from sub-district headquarter Kumbhraj (tehsildar office) and 75km away from district headquarter Guna. As per 2009 stats, Aamkheda is the gram panchayat of Bad Nagar village.

About Bad Nagar
According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Bad Nagar is 499592. The village spans a total geographical area of 226 hectares. Kumbhraj is nearest town to Bad Nagar village for all major economic activities, which is approximately 15km away.
When it comes to local governance, Bad Nagar village is administered by a Sarpanch, the elected head of the village, in accordance with the Constitution of India and the Panchayati Raj Act. The village falls under the Chachoura Vidhan Sabha constituency for state-level representation and the Rajgarh Lok Sabha constituency for national parliamentary elections. Population of Bad Nagar
According to the 2011 Census, Bad Nagar has a total population of about 607, with approximately 320 males and 287 females. The sex ratio is around 896 females per 1,000 males. Children aged 0 to 6 years make up about 65 of the population, showing the young generation present in the village. Details about the Scheduled Castes (SC) community are not available. Information about the Scheduled Tribes (ST) population is not available. The overall literacy rate is approximately 59.31%, with male literacy at about 72.81% and female literacy near 44.25%. There are around 102 households in the village. Together, these details offer a clear picture of Bad Nagar's population size, gender balance, young residents, literacy levels, and social makeup.
Particulars | Total | Male | Female |
---|---|---|---|
Total Population | 607 | 320 | 287 |
Child Population (0–6 yrs) | 65 | 34 | 31 |
Scheduled Castes (SC) | N/A | N/A | N/A |
Scheduled Tribes (ST) | N/A | N/A | N/A |
Literate Population | 360 | 233 | 127 |
Illiterate Population | 247 | 87 | 160 |
Connectivity of Bad Nagar
Connectivity plays a major role in improving access, opportunities, and overall development of villages like Bad Nagar. As per the 2011 stats, Bad Nagar had access to public bus service, private bus service and railway station.
Connectivity Type | Status (in year 2011) |
---|---|
Public Bus Service | Available within 5 - 10 km distance |
Private Bus Service | Available within 5 - 10 km distance |
Railway Station | Available within 10+ km distance |
